Winner Declared In 43rd District State Rep Primary: Report
UPDATE: The state representative race was between Kate Rotella and Chris Donahue
UPDATE: According to the New London Day, endorsed Democratic candidate Kate Rotella came out ahead of challenger Chris Donahue in the 43rd District state representative race.

STONINGTON, CT ā Voting will take place from 6 a.m to 8 p.m. on Tuesday, Aug. 14 in Stonington for those waging a primary race for office across the state and locally.

On the Republican side, there are no local primaries.
For governor, it is a five-way race between party endorsed Danbury Mayor Mark Boughton, Timothy Herbst, Steve Obsitnik, Bob Stefanowski and David Stemerman; lieutenant governor is a three-way race between Joe Markley, Jayme Stevenson and Erin Stewart.

The U.S. Senate seat to contest Chris Murphy this fall is a primary battle between Matthew Corey and Dominic Rapini; there is a state treasurer contest between Thad Gray and Art Linares; a comptroller race between Kurt Miller and Mark Greenberg; and an attorney general race between Sue Hatfield and John Shaban.
On the Democratic side, there are both state and local contests.
The Democratic primaries are the big ones: Ned Lamont is facing a challenge from Bridgeport Mayor Joseph Ganim to be the party's candidate this November for governor; for lieutenant governor, Susan Bysiewicz is facing a primary challenge from Eva Bermudez Zimmerman; there is state representative race between Kate Rotella and Chris Donahue; for treasurer, Shawn Wooden is being challenged by Dita Bhargava; the race for attorney general is a three-way contest, between party endorsed William Tong, Paul Doyle and Chris Mattei.
